Documented History (by the NGS)
01/01/1942 by CGS (MONUMENTED) |
DESCRIBED BY COAST AND GEODETIC SURVEY 1942
1 MI S FROM GETTYSBURG. 1.0 MILE SOUTH ALONG U.S. HIGHWAY 140 FROM THE RAILROAD STATION AT GETTYSBURG, ADAMS COUNTY, 61.7 FEET NORTH OF THE NORTH CORNER OF A CREAM PAINTED HOUSE, 43.3 FEET NORTH OF A POLE, IN THE TOP OF THE NORTH END OF A CULVERT, AND 21.7 FEET WEST OF THE CENTER LINE OF THE HIGHWAY. A STANDARD DISK, STAMPED S 193 1942. |
Control Text
- The horizontal coordinates were scaled from a topographic map and have an estimated accuracy of +/- 6 seconds.
- The orthometric height was determined by differential leveling and adjusted by the National Geodetic Survey in June 1991.
- The geoid height was determined by GEOID99.
- The dynamic height is computed by dividing the NAVD 88 geopotential number by the normal gravity value computed on the Geodetic Reference System of 1980 (GRS 80) ellipsoid at 45 degrees latitude (g = 980.6199 gals.).
- The modeled gravity was interpolated from observed gravity values.
